WebCountess of Harcourt Voyages to Australia. Ship of 517 tons, built in India 1811. Voyages to NSW and VDL 1821, 1822, 1824, 1827 & 1828. WebDetails of ADM 101/18/4; Reference: ADM 101/18/4 Description: Medical journal of the Countess of Harcourt, convict ship, from 21 December 1826 to 11 July 1827 by Michael Goodsir, surgeon and superintendent, during which time the ship was employed in taking convicts from Kingston harbour Dunlary to New South Wales.. WebThomas Wootton, one of 172 convicts transported on the ship Countess of Harcourt, 16 March 1824. Sentence details: Convicted at Stafford Quarter Sessions for a term of 7 years on 15 October 1823. Vessel: Countess of Harcourt. Date of Departure: 16 March 1824. Place of Arrival: New South Wales.
